Background: MPPE1 encodes a metallophosphoesterase protein that is widely brain expressed and is a member of the calcineurin-like phosphoesterase superfamily. Phosphoesterases are involved in a variety of diverse biochemical reactions, including protein phosphorylation-dephosphorylation processes that modulate functional properties of proteins. The MPPE1 gene is located on chromosome 18p11.21 and is flanked by the G protein Golf alpha (GNAL) gene and the myo-inositol monophosphatase gene (IMPA2). Variation in the MPPE1 gene might lead to an altered enzyme with downstream effects on protein phosphorylation involved in cellular signaling.
